For a while, we thought hottie Leo DiCaprio sank with the Titanic. The Beach was a little strange and it came and went. Where has Leo been? Now we know! It's a DiCaprio Christmas this year. The handsome star has two films on screens at present and they couldn't be more different. In Scorsese's Gangs of New York, Leo plays an immigrant bent on revenge for his dad's death in 1863 New York. In Spielberg's Catch Me If You Can, he's a 1960's con artist bent on regaining his dad's lost fortune.... Humm, did we say different? In New York, the actor talked to press about his two roles and his passion for environmental causes.

Someone brings Leo water.

Leo:(dramatically) Evian on request!

TeenHollywood: Why do we love con artists so much?

Leo: Because they're great actors, I suppose. They're able to manipulate their surroundings to their liking. There haven't been that many movies about con artists lately. Maybe The Talented Mr. Ripley was one. It's certainly fascinating and adventurous to go on the journey of the character and see how they are able to manipulate their environments like that.
